news 2026/2/3 2:42:48

革命性Cron表达式生成工具:no-vue3-cron让定时任务配置不再难

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
革命性Cron表达式生成工具:no-vue3-cron让定时任务配置不再难

革命性Cron表达式生成工具:no-vue3-cron让定时任务配置不再难

【免费下载链接】no-vue3-cron这是一个 cron 表达式生成插件,基于 vue3.0 与 element-plus 实现项目地址: https://gitcode.com/gh_mirrors/no/no-vue3-cron

你是否曾因记不住Cron表达式(定时任务语法规则)的复杂格式而头疼?是否在配置定时任务时反复检查却依然出错?现在,基于Vue 3.0和Element Plus开发的no-vue3-cron可视化生成工具,彻底解决了这些痛点。这款工具通过直观的图形界面,让你无需记忆任何语法就能轻松创建准确的定时任务规则,即使是技术小白也能秒变定时任务配置专家。

如何通过可视化界面彻底解决Cron配置难题?

no-vue3-cron的核心价值在于将抽象的Cron语法转化为直观的可视化操作。想象一下,传统配置Cron表达式就像用代码画简笔画,而使用no-vue3-cron则如同用鼠标在画图软件中创作——你只需点击选择,系统会自动生成对应的表达式。工具提供从秒到年的全维度时间单位配置,每个时间维度都有独立的选项卡,让复杂的时间规则变得清晰可控。

零基础配置教程:3步完成定时任务设置

📌第一步:安装与引入
通过npm安装组件后,在Vue项目中简单引入即可使用。核心代码只需一行:import noVue3Cron from 'no-vue3-cron',然后在模板中添加<noVue3Cron></noVue3Cron>标签。

📌第二步:配置时间参数
在弹出的配置面板中,通过六个选项卡分别设置秒、分、时、日、月、年的规则。每个选项卡都提供"每单位执行"、"间隔执行"、"特定值"和"范围执行"四种模式,满足各种定时需求。

📌第三步:获取Cron表达式
完成配置后,工具会自动生成对应的Cron表达式,直接复制即可用于你的定时任务系统。修改时也只需调整界面选项,无需手动修改表达式。

三大真实场景解决方案,覆盖90%定时需求

场景一:电商平台秒杀活动定时开启

需求:每月1日、15日上午10:00准时开启促销活动
传统方式:需手动编写0 0 10 1,15 * ? *
no-vue3-cron操作:在"日"选项卡选择"特定日期"并勾选1和15,在"时"选项卡选择"特定时间"并输入10,系统自动生成上述表达式。🎉

场景二:社交媒体定时发布

需求:每周一至周五下午3点发布内容
传统方式:需记忆0 0 15 ? * MON-FRI *
no-vue3-cron操作:在"星期"选项卡选择"特定星期"并勾选周一至周五,在"时"选项卡选择15点,界面实时显示生成的表达式。📅

场景三:服务器资源监控报告

需求:每小时的第15分钟执行一次系统检查
传统方式:易错写为15 * * * * ? *(正确应为0 15 * * * ? *
no-vue3-cron操作:在"分钟"选项卡选择"特定分钟"并输入15,工具自动生成正确表达式,避免语法错误。🔍

工作原理解析:像搭积木一样构建Cron表达式

no-vue3-cron的工作原理可以类比为"积木拼图":每个时间单位(秒、分、时等)都是一个独立的积木块,你只需选择每个积木块的样式(执行模式),系统会自动将这些积木组合成完整的Cron表达式。内部通过Vue 3.0的响应式机制,实时将界面操作转化为对应的语法规则,并通过内置验证机制确保生成的表达式有效。

专家级进阶技巧:解锁隐藏功能

技巧一:时间区间与步长组合

在"小时"选项卡选择"范围执行",设置从9到18点,步长为2,即可实现9:00、11:00、13:00...的间隔执行,表达式自动生成为0 0 9-18/2 * * ? *

技巧二:快速切换中英文界面

点击界面右上角的语言按钮,可一键切换中英文显示,无需复杂配置。语言文件位于packages/no-vue3-cron/language/目录,支持自定义扩展其他语言。

技巧三:表达式导入与修改

直接在输入框粘贴现有Cron表达式,工具会自动解析并还原为界面配置,让你能够可视化修改已有定时任务。

常见误区对比:这些错误你是否也犯过?

错误案例正确示范错误原因
0 30 12 31 2 *0 30 12 28-29 2 ?2月不存在31日,工具会自动过滤无效日期
* 15 * * *0 15 * * * ? *遗漏星期字段,工具默认补全正确格式
0 0 0 * * 00 0 0 ? * SUN日期和星期同时指定导致冲突,工具自动处理优先级

总结:让定时任务配置像玩游戏一样简单

no-vue3-cron通过可视化界面彻底颠覆了传统Cron表达式的配置方式,无论是日常任务调度还是复杂的周期性需求,都能通过简单的点击操作完成。现在就通过git clone https://gitcode.com/gh_mirrors/no/no-vue3-cron获取项目,体验这款革命性工具带来的效率提升吧!告别语法记忆,让定时任务配置从此变得轻松愉快。🚀

【免费下载链接】no-vue3-cron这是一个 cron 表达式生成插件,基于 vue3.0 与 element-plus 实现项目地址: https://gitcode.com/gh_mirrors/no/no-vue3-cron

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/2/1 16:47:39

Unity AI视觉开发新范式:MediaPipe集成实战指南

Unity AI视觉开发新范式&#xff1a;MediaPipe集成实战指南 【免费下载链接】MediaPipeUnityPlugin Unity plugin to run MediaPipe 项目地址: https://gitcode.com/gh_mirrors/me/MediaPipeUnityPlugin 在当今的Unity开发领域&#xff0c;实时视觉处理技术正成为AR/VR应…

作者头像 李华
网站建设 2026/1/31 17:56:18

超实用嵌入式工具LCD Image Converter位图转换全攻略

超实用嵌入式工具LCD Image Converter位图转换全攻略 【免费下载链接】lcd-image-converter Tool to create bitmaps and fonts for embedded applications, v.2 项目地址: https://gitcode.com/gh_mirrors/lc/lcd-image-converter LCD Image Converter是一款专为嵌入式…

作者头像 李华
网站建设 2026/2/1 7:45:55

高效股票数据导出实战:从格式适配到批量处理的全流程优化

高效股票数据导出实战&#xff1a;从格式适配到批量处理的全流程优化 【免费下载链接】stock stock&#xff0c;股票系统。使用python进行开发。 项目地址: https://gitcode.com/gh_mirrors/st/stock 你是否遇到过导出的股票数据格式杂乱、关键指标缺失&#xff1f;是否…

作者头像 李华
网站建设 2026/1/29 2:18:15

三步打造专业级在线设计工具:Vue-Fabric-Editor零门槛实践指南

三步打造专业级在线设计工具&#xff1a;Vue-Fabric-Editor零门槛实践指南 【免费下载链接】vue-fabric-editor nihaojob/vue-fabric-editor: 这是基于Vue.js和Fabric.js开发的一款富文本编辑器组件&#xff0c;Fabric.js是一个强大的HTML5 canvas交互库&#xff0c;该组件利用…

作者头像 李华
网站建设 2026/2/2 6:17:19

Qwen All-in-One多语言支持?中英文切换实战

Qwen All-in-One多语言支持&#xff1f;中英文切换实战 1. 为什么“单模型干两件事”值得你花3分钟看懂 你有没有遇到过这样的场景&#xff1a; 想给一个轻量级应用加个情感分析功能&#xff0c;结果发现得额外装BERT、下载几GB权重、还要配CUDA环境——最后发现服务器连GPU都…

作者头像 李华